The Mesquite Independent School District board on Dec. 8 approved the selection of Buford Thompson Company as Construction Manager at Risk (CMAR) for Package 1 (Motley/Lawrence Replacement Elementary) and accepted three Guaranteed Maximum Prices for current elementary renovation work.
Trustees unanimously approved a GMP of $174,309 for Beasley Elementary switch gear; WRA and MISD Construction Services reported a total construction cost estimate at 77% plans of $2,488,740.16 for the Beasley renovation. The board also approved a $763,159 GMP for Gray Elementary chiller and switch gear and a $202,679 GMP for Moss Elementary switch gear. The Gray Elementary total cost estimate at 7% plans was listed as $6,662,828.32; the Moss Elementary estimate at 77% plans is $5,483,213.18.
The motions passed by recorded unanimous votes. Trustees cited construction planning and recommended vendor reviews by WRA Architects, Inc. and MISD Construction Services in supporting the motions. No details on project schedules or funding sources beyond the GMPs and cost estimates were provided at the meeting.
